Over 150 people have volunteered to CASE since its inception providing thousands of hours of time to ensure the legal rights of refugees are upheld. Each week over 100 hours of time is donated by a team of volunteer lawyers, law and social work students and migration agents. Without their continued support, CASE would not have been able to achieve all it has in such a short time. So why not volunteer today?
By becoming a volunteer for CASE for Refugees, you automatically become a member of the organisation. Your contribution to CASE is essential in maintaining the professional services we provide to our clients.
Your membership fee allows CASE to assist clients free of charge.
